"Populaire" is a delightful romantic comedy directed by Régis Roinsard, starring Romain Duris, Bérénice Bejo, Féodor Atkine, and Déborah François. Set in the 1950s, the film follows Rose Pamphyle (Déborah François), a small-town girl with a talent for typing at lightning speed. When she meets Louis Echard (Romain Duris), a charismatic and competitive insurance agent, he recognizes her potential and becomes her coach as she enters typing competitions. As Rose's skills improve, their relationship blossoms into a charming romance filled with humor, heart, and plenty of retro flair. Released in 2012, "Populaire" is a lighthearted blend of comedy, romance, and sport that transports viewers to a bygone era.
